Do you have an idea what this means?

This is what my Economic professor told us on our first meeting and the very first time I heard about it too.

There's no such thing as free lunch. - John Ruskin

When we say free lunch, it means you did not pay for it because it's FREE.

in Filipino,

Libre.

But is it really free? No it is not.

This adage means that things that may seem free ALWAYS have some implicit or hidden cost to it...maybe not for you but for someone else.

This is a really simple analogy: You ordered something online and it comes with a freebie. You didn't pay for it but the seller did so it means that it is actually not free for someone's point of view.

Walang libre sa mundo. Kapag may nanlibre sayo sa Jollibee, may ibang gagastos. Kapag may napulot kang bente, dugo't pawis 'yun ng ibang tao. Kapag nag 1 2 3 ka sa jeep, kawalan 'yun ng kita sa driver.
